📚 Contexto Histórico
Psalm 7 is attributed to King David and is believed to have been written during a period of intense personal conflict, likely when he was fleeing from enemies such as King Saul, who sought to kill him unjustly. In the broader biblical narrative, this psalm reflects the ancient Israelite practice of appealing to God as a divine warrior and judge for protection and vindication. David's words highlight the cultural context of relying on God's covenant faithfulness amid threats and accusations.
